The Courageous Leaders Podcast aims to inspire leaders to step into their courageous zone, be the leader they know they can be and discover the mindset skills and behaviours to take their leadership to the next level.
So listen in, get inspired on how you can grow your leadership impact. Leave a legacy you can be proud of, and build an environment for future leaders to thrive.
Who is Joanna Howes?
Joanna Howes is an award-winning international coach, behavioural expert, specialising in leadership and performance coaching and No 1 best selling international co-author.
Her focus is to help individuals and teams activate their full potential, so they can step into their courageous zone to maximise their influence, build their resilience and take the action needed to become high performers and future-ready leaders.
Joanna is a unique phenomenon within her industry, with over 20 years’ experience working internationally with some of the world's most awarded advertising agencies and leading them to operational and leadership success. Her blend of both innovative operational and transformative change solutions empowers organisations to create environments that are supportive and fearless for their employees.

Patrick Jeffrey: How To Embrace The Unknown With Confidence
Season 16 · Episode 118
jeudi 29 août 2024 • Duration 34:28
Feeling lost or low on confidence?
Patrick Jeffery, MD of Contagious, shares his journey of overcoming self-doubt and embracing the power of being a generalist.
Patrick reveals how he turned his fear of failure into a driving force for success, drawing inspiration from sports legend Roger Federer on the importance of resetting and letting go.
Whether you're at a career crossroads or looking to boost your confidence, Patrick's story will inspire you to embrace your unique path and find strength in your versatility.
02:07 The risk of driving change too quickly
07:32 Becoming a ‘specialist generalist’ leader.
10:20 Soft skills being a leaders superpower
15:15 How to make lots of decisions
17:40 The ability to build confidence
23:44 Being terrified of failure and how to navigate this
26:26 Imposter syndrome as a positive
31:01 Letting go of ‘what if’s’ and focusing on controllables

Alex Grieve: Exploring Employee Wellbeing
Season 16 · Episode 117
jeudi 22 août 2024 • Duration 38:01
In this episode, we sit down with Alex Grieve, CCO at BBH, who shares his transformative journey from a creative role to a leadership position.
Alex opens up about the challenges he faced in his early career, navigating a highly competitive and alpha-male dominated industry.
He discusses the immense pressure to constantly prove himself and deliver exceptional creative work, which often led to self-doubt and burnout.
Alex also reflects on his initial reluctance to step into leadership and his experiences of learning from failures as a new leader. He reveals how he found his flow, leading with calm, clarity, and conciseness.
00:00 Getting out of bed even on the difficult days
04:16 The challenge of working in an elite performance culture
09:35 Finding a collaborative environment at AMV
12:01 Reluctant transition from creative to leadership
16:14 Learning from early failures
19:43 Importance of rest in combating burnout.
22:21 Learning to be calm, enjoying the process and letting go of the outcome.
25:00 Kindness and support in leadership is crucial
29:28 Learning to be honest and candid with people.
33:50 Gratitude for teamwork is crucial in leadership.

Harjot Singh: Why We Need to Stop Protecting the Myth That We Have It All Together
Season 3 · Episode 23
mercredi 1 juin 2022 • Duration 36:26
Over the last few decades Harjot has held senior regional and global strategy leadership roles in Europe, UK, North America, China and Asia. He joined McCann New York in 2011, and prior to being named global CSO of McCann, he served as CSO McCann EMEA, leading it to be the number one most creatively effective Agency Network for five years! This led to the 2020 CSO of the year for Campaign.
This is such a feel-good episode, and you are guaranteed to come away feeling better! Harjot speaks beautifully about how he learned what it was like to not be friends with his inner voice, the importance of gratitude and starting with thanks and why we need to stop protecting the myth that we have it all together.
Key takeaways include:
- How the absence of fear creates courage
- How to stop self-sabotaging
- Why it’s ok to change the label you are given
- Why feedback isn’t always fact
- The importance of gratitude and starting with thanks
- How you can Marie Kondo your life and your leadership
- The lessons from the pandemic that we need to take forward in our leadership

Steve Bell: ‘The Truth Behind Building a Culture That Works Globally’
Season 3 · Episode 22
mercredi 25 mai 2022 • Duration 35:56
Steve Bell is the Global CEO of Iris
Steve oversees Iris’ 17 offices and 1,000 employees within the network. In the 25 years that he has worked in the marketing and communications industry, he has worked with some of the most innovative, ambitious and creatively driven businesses in the automotive, sports, FMCG, beer, retail spirits, and Telco sectors.
In this episode ‘The truth behind building a culture that works globally’, Steve shares so much wisdom that you will find helpful. He talks openly and honestly about the lessons he has learned throughout his career, and in particular, from setting up Iris to achieve the success it has today.
Key takeaways include:
- the value of bringing your authentic self
- the difference between leadership and management
- how Iris created clear lines of responsibility
- how to evolve a culture in global organisation
- the need to feel good about what you’re doing as a leader
- how to value your time, to be an effective leader
- knowing when to lead from the front and when to step back
- how to make board meetings more effective
- the parallel between sport and business

Brie Stewart: Recognising High Functioning Depression and Ways to Cope
Season 3 · Episode 20
mercredi 11 mai 2022 • Duration 31:12
Brie Stewart is a Creative Director, formerly at Wunderman Thompson
In this episode Brie talks openly about her experience with high functioning depression, the importance of talking about it, and the support she received from the industry when she did.
She also shares how she became a better leader by no longer trying to be a hero, unlearning past behaviours and saying no.
Brie is an award winning Creative Director with over 13 years experience including working at esteemed Public Relations Agency Edelman, and the advertising agencies Ogilvy, Clemenger BBDO, and most recently Wunderman Thompson.
This episode is filled with so much wisdom, insights and important messages, and really is a must listen for all creative leaders.
Topics covered include:
- How to be comfortable with not being perfect
- The courage to say “I’m not ok”
- Being busy is not a badge of honour
- There is a ‘no’ in every ‘yes’
- The courage to be disliked

Nils Leonard: Remove Fear From the Equation
Season 3 · Episode 19
mercredi 4 mai 2022 • Duration 44:53
Nils Leonard is Founder of Uncommon Creative Studio
In this episode Nils shares his wealth of experience and some powerful insights into how to remove fear from your leadership.
He also talks candidly about why we need to differentiate between being in a client services business and the creativity business, the importance of having a view of the world, to really create impact and make your work matter and why you need to let go of the need to be dependent on other people to achieve your dreams.
Just in case there is anyone out there who doesn’t know who Nils is, he is the Co-Founder of the fastest growing startup in advertising history, Uncommon Creative Studio.
He also spent time as Chief Creative Officer of Grey LDN, where he oversaw the most profitable and awarded years in the agency’s 52 years history and became one of the youngest agency chairmen in the world leading its brands globally and locally.
He was voted into the Ad Age creativity 50 and named the most creative person in advertising globally by Business insider, is on the advisory group for the Royal Academy, and is listed as one of Sunday Times 500 Most Influential People in the UK.
Topics covered include:
- Embracing change
- Converting frustration into success
- The importance of conviction
- The courage to be your authentic self
- Need for change
- Standing by your values
- How being open about company standards provides clarity of expectations

Luke D’Arcy: The biggest lesson for a leader: It’s not about you!
Season 2 · Episode 18
jeudi 7 avril 2022 • Duration 33:22
Luke D'Arcy is the EMEA Growth Officer at Momentum Worldwide
In this episode Luke gives us an insight into how he felt being in a room with Astronauts and Generals who have served in Afghanistan and yet all had the same fears and beliefs about being good enough and what a humbling experience this was.
Luke shares that the minute you think you have nailed it as a leader you are at a loss. He explains that you can’t know all the answers. We are human beings and a lot of people forget that.
Luke explains that accepting that leadership is not about one’s self, is a valuable lesson he has learnt and one that continues to shape him and his leadership style.
Luke runs Momentum UK, the most awarded global experiential advertising agency in the world, working for clients such as American Express, Microsoft, SAP and Samsung.
Under Luke’s guidance, in 2020, Momentum UK won The Drum’s Marketing Agency of the Year and Creativepool’s Best Agency to Work for. Previously, the agency has won 18 x Cannes Lions amongst many other awards.
Named one of their Global Agency Innovators of the Year by Internationalist Magazine, Luke is also a Harvard Business School Alumni, has worked across numerous global networks and independents and is a Trustee of military charity Walking With The Wounded.
Topics Covered include:
- Setting clear standards and values
- Embracing courage
- It's ok to not know the answer
- Embracing your weaknesses
- The role of perspective
- How to empower your team
- The power of trusting your gut instinct
